It's hard to say without a picture.
If it's sewn together, watch to make sure the stitches are firm and can't be seen. And all loose threads are trimmed.
If it's glued, not a good idea.
If there is any embroidery on it, nails can catch.
It should be made of blizzard, polar, or antipill fleece. Basically you shouldn't be able to see any woven material.
Fur or minky fleece can catch nails too.
